read the original abstract

The value of the $\eta - \eta'$ mixing angle $\theta_P$ is phenomenologically deduced from a rather exhaustive and up-to-date analysis of data including strong decays of tensor and higher-spin mesons, electromagnetic decays of vector and pseudoscalar mesons, $J/\psi$ decays into a vector and a pseudoscalar meson, and other transitions. A value of $\theta_P$ between $-17^\circ$ and $-13^\circ$ is consistent with all the present experimental evidence and the average $\theta_P=-15.5^\circ\pm 1.3^\circ$ seems to be favoured.
